Method and apparatus for video encoding and decoding

A video coding and video decoding technology, which is applied in the field of video coding and decoding, can solve the problems of reducing the error recovery ability of the intra-frame refresh method, and achieve the effects of improving coding and decoding performance, ensuring error recovery performance, and improving coding efficiency

Active Publication Date: 2010-03-24
HUAWEI TECH CO LTD
View PDF0 Cites 65 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0006] In the above-mentioned intra-frame refresh method, if the adjacent macroblock of a certain refreshed macroblock is an inter-predicted macroblock (i.e. P macroblock), since the P macroblock may refer to the previous P frame, the P macroblock will be It is possible to accumulate the corres

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Method and apparatus for video encoding and decoding
  • Method and apparatus for video encoding and decoding
  • Method and apparatus for video encoding and decoding

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0087] The following will clearly and completely describe the technical solutions in the embodiments of the present invention with reference to the accompanying drawings in the embodiments of the present invention. Obviously, the described embodiments are only some, not all, embodiments of the present invention. Based on the embodiments of the present invention, all other embodiments obtained by persons of ordinary skill in the art without creative efforts fall within the protection scope of the present invention.

[0088] The implementation scheme provided by the embodiment of the present invention can realize the flexible selection of the reference block at the sub-block level. Specifically, in the process of selecting the prediction mode of the current intra-coded sub-block, the adjacent block is an intra-coded block (using Adjacent blocks coded in intra prediction mode) or inter coded blocks (adjacent blocks coded in inter prediction mode), select whether the current sub-bl...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

The invention provides a method and apparatus for video encoding and decoding. At the coding end, selection of intra-frame prediction mode of the current coding block can be performed in accordance with adjacent blocks, and encoding operation of the current encoding block can be performed by selection of the intra-frame selection mode, wherein, when the limited DC prediction mode is selected as the intra-frame prediction mode, if the current encoding block is in the same macroblock with each adjacent encoding block, the adjacent blocks are available, otherwise, all the adjacent blocks are unavailable; or, if at least one of the encoded adjacent blocks is the intra-frame prediction block, all the adjacent blocks are unavailable; or, all the adjacent blocks are unavailable. Upon parsing andobtaining the intra-frame prediction mode adopted by the current decoding block at the decoding end, decoding operation can be performed according to the intra-frame prediction mode adopted by the current decoding block which is obtained by parsing. By adopting a limited DC prediction mode, the embodiment of the invention is not only capable of ensuring error recovery performance, but also capableof enhancing encoding efficiency of the intra-frame updating macroblock, as well as improving performance of encoding and decoding.

Description

technical field [0001] The present invention relates to the field of communication technology, in particular to a video codec technology. Background technique [0002] In the video communication system, video data error or packet loss is usually unavoidable. Therefore, it is necessary to adopt corresponding measures to improve the anti-error ability of video data, so that the video information can recover from the error as soon as possible, and provide users with Provide a better subjective experience. [0003] At present, an anti-error code implementation solution provided is an intra-frame refresh method, through corresponding intra-frame refresh, corresponding error recovery can be realized to a certain extent. Such as figure 1 As shown, the P frame is encoded using the inter-frame mode, and the corresponding IR frame is a refresh frame, and part or all of the macroblocks in the IR frame are encoded using the intra-frame coding mode, that is, the intra-frame coding in t...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
IPC IPC(8): H04N7/64H04N7/32H04N19/89H04N19/593
CPCH04N7/26026H04N7/26207H04N19/00763H04N19/00042H04N19/00212H04N7/345H04N19/11H04N19/157H04N19/593
Inventor 赖昌材郑萧桢林永兵
Owner HUAWEI TECH CO LTD
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products